The Growing Role of AI Translation in Legal Workflows
Legal teams today operate in a global environment. Contracts, compliance filings, litigation materials, and investigations frequently involve multiple languages, making legal document translation a routine requirement.
AI translation for legal teams is growing rapidly, but when sensitive data is involved, speed without control can introduce serious legal and compliance risks.
To manage increasing volumes, many organisations are adopting AI translation for legal teams to improve speed and efficiency. These tools can process large datasets quickly, supporting early-stage review and internal workflows.
However, legal content is inherently sensitive. Documents often contain confidential information, privileged communications, and regulated data. This makes AI Translation and Data Privacy a critical consideration, not just a technical one.
AI can support legal workflows at scale, but without proper governance, it introduces risks related to confidentiality, compliance, and evidentiary reliability.

Data Privacy Risks in AI Translation Platforms
Many AI translation tools operate on cloud-based infrastructure, requiring users to upload documents to external systems.
This creates several risks related to AI Translation and Data Privacy, including:
- Storage of sensitive data on third-party servers
- Data processing in unknown jurisdictions
- Potential use of uploaded data for model training
- Unclear data retention policies
- Insufficient encryption or access controls
These risks are well-documented across the legal and technology sectors. Public AI platforms, in particular, may not provide the level of confidentiality required for legal work.
For example, uploading draft contracts or litigation documents to public AI platforms can expose sensitive clauses to external servers, creating risks related to confidentiality, data ownership, and compliance.
Regulatory and Compliance Challenges
Legal teams must ensure that translation workflows comply with applicable data protection and confidentiality regulations.
Relevant frameworks include:
- GDPR for personal data protection in Europe
- HIPAA when handling healthcare-related legal data
- Industry-specific regulations across finance, government, and compliance sectors
Improper handling of data during AI legal translation can result in violations of these regulations.
In addition, contractual obligations often require strict confidentiality, which may be compromised when using unsecured tools.
In many jurisdictions, legal documents submitted in court or regulatory filings must meet strict accuracy and certification standards, which AI-generated translations alone may not satisfy.
Privilege and Evidentiary Risks in AI Translation
Attorney-client privilege depends on maintaining confidentiality throughout legal processes.
Using unsecured AI tools may expose privileged communications to third parties, potentially undermining legal protections.
Other risks include:
- Challenges to the authenticity of translated documents
- Disputes over translation accuracy
- Questions around admissibility of AI-generated content in court
Courts may require human verification to validate translated evidence, particularly in litigation scenarios.
When AI Translation Can Be Defensible
AI translation can be used safely in controlled, low-risk legal workflows.
Examples include:
- Preliminary document screening in multilingual discovery
- Internal research and content familiarisation
- Early-stage review of non-sensitive documents
- Draft translations before professional review
In these cases, AI translation for legal teams acts as a support tool rather than a final output.
The key condition is that sensitive or legally binding content is not solely dependent on AI-generated translation.
In practice, many legal teams use AI only as a first-pass tool, with all critical documents undergoing human review before final use.
When AI Translation Becomes Risky for Legal Teams
There are scenarios where reliance on AI translation introduces significant legal risk.
These include:
- Translating confidential contracts using public AI platforms
- Handling privileged attorney-client communications
- Translating court submissions or regulatory filings without verification
- Processing personal data protected under strict privacy laws
In such cases, relying solely on AI legal translation can expose organisations to compliance violations and legal disputes.
In these scenarios, relying solely on AI is not just inefficient—it can directly impact legal outcomes, compliance standing, and client confidentiality.
Best Practices for Using AI Translation Safely in Legal Workflows
To balance efficiency with risk, legal teams should establish clear governance frameworks.
Recommended practices include:
- Defining acceptable use cases for AI translation
- Avoiding the use of unsecured public platforms for sensitive documents
- Using secure environments designed for confidential data
- Ensuring human review by qualified legal linguists
- Maintaining documentation for audit and compliance purposes
These steps help ensure that AI Translation and Data Privacy requirements are met while still benefiting from automation.
